Material formulation design is one of the key steps of PVC wood-plastic composite microcellular foaming. The melt viscosity and stiffness of PVC are increased by adding wood fibre, making it difficult to obtain high porosity. On the other hand, wood powder has strong water absorption and strong polarity, while PVC resin is non-polar and hydrophobic, so the compatibility between the two is poor and the bonding force of the interface is very small. Appropriate additives should be added to improve the interface affinity between wood powder and PVC resin. At the same time also need to add a variety of additives to improve its processing performance and the use of finished products.
The Expansion of Raw Materials in WPC Products
Adding foaming agent to the raw material of WPC for foaming extrusion, the foamed WPC has a good cellular structure, which can passivate the crack tip and effectively prevent the crack expansion, thus significantly improving the impact resistance and toughness of the material. The product density is close to the wood, while the mechanical strength is higher than wood, which makes it can be used as a good substitute for wood, and the product cost is reduced, which further widens the application range of WPC.
Stabilizer in Wood Plastic Composite Decking Products
An ideal stable system should be a reasonable combination of several stabilizers. One of the keys to control the processing technology of WPC is to prevent the thermal degradation of plastics and wood powder during mixing and moulding. The wood powder has poor thermal stability, and cellulose and lignin in it are easy to decompose. When oxygen exists at 190℃ or so, it will start to smoke and change colour. At the same time, due to the close processing temperature and decomposition temperature of PVC, sufficient heat stabilizer must be added in the processing to improve its degradation temperature. In the production of PVC WPC composite microporous foaming materials, the use of composite lead stabilizer, organic tin stabilizer, calcium and zinc stabilizer.
Plasticizer in Wood Plastic Composite material
PVC resin melt flow viscosity is relatively high, and wood powder complex often needs to add plasticizer to improve its processing performance. Add plasticizer can lower processing temperature, molecular structure of plasticizer contained two polar and nonpolar groups, under the high-temperature shearing action, it can into the polymer molecular chain, through the polar group attracted to each other to form uniform and stable system, and its long nonpolar molecule is weakened into the polymer molecules attracted to each other, so as to make the process easier. Lubricants and lubricants are important influencing factors for extrusion of PVC wood-plastic composite foamed materials. Suitable lubricants are needed to improve the fluidity and surface quality of extrusion products, and lubricants are good dispersants for pigments in composites. Lubricant has a certain influence on the service life of mould, barrel, screw, surface finish and low-temperature impact performance.
